js中的排序函数??

arr1.sort(sortNumber);

document.write(arr1);

function sortNumber(a,b){

return b-a;

}

js中的sort(sortNumber)里面参数是个函数,为啥不带括号()?sort(sortNumber())这样写不行吗?

qq_天蝎的尾巴卍_0
浏览 1337回答 1
1回答

Caballarii

当然不行,不带括号是变量,类型是函数,带了括号是表达式,结果是这个函数return的内容
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ript